Output 6afc80274cfbbf12d6c16e52becdc0b7caaa4e960cc4f9fbbfaad8ccf0d7ebaa:1

value
6952407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54408c1403398cd2ca69959e934de9ce1861afca OP_EQUAL
address
39NW1UTYg4FYsSXCduY5quV6UckQp7G9U5
transaction
6afc80274cfbbf12d6c16e52becdc0b7caaa4e960cc4f9fbbfaad8ccf0d7ebaa
confirmations
294681
spent
true